  In this twelfth-century medieval historical adventure, Richard the Lionhearted attempts to reclaim the throne of England.
 
It is winter in England, 1192. Richard Coeur de Lion, the battle-hardened warrior-king, has been captured and imprisoned returning from the Crusades--after spending only a few months in the land he is supposed to rule.
 
As the winter snow melts, England pays the price of being a kingdom without a king. For Richard's jealous and spiteful brother John, not content with robbing his brother's subjects of all they have, plans insurrection to wrest the throne itself . . .
 
But then a second message comes, one which chills even John's thin blood: “Le diable étoit déchaîné,” -- “The devil is loose!” The game is on, and the kingdom is at a stake.
